Output 322ea8ef9f1c42a80a35e2768f307da620e5d15bb8e6bc9877791bc756dea43b:2

value
40430467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e45f753c90a167de9a1cad7b9fbc56e20eeee63c OP_EQUAL
address
MUigehhbpHcu7q67pa6ehuGfVqiAtS6dQf
transaction
322ea8ef9f1c42a80a35e2768f307da620e5d15bb8e6bc9877791bc756dea43b
spent
true